Middle Summer Wedding
A middle summer wedding focused on this unique flower-palette, composed of warm colors with some darker touches, for a bright and elegant effect. We have chosen many varieties of flowers to reach this result, mixing small wildflowers with more precious flowers such as roses and dahlias, which express all their brightest shades during this part of the season. The symbolic ceremony was in an iconic place: the small Church of Masseria San Giovanni, in Fasano. The guest chairs are arranged in a semicircle to create an intimate atmosphere. We arranged natural growths of flowers along the aisle to follow the bride’s walkway. Bushes seem to climb up the Church facade, framing the entrance door with an asymmetric arch. The wedding banquet was under a stretch tent, with a sober set-up and intimate atmosphere. The idea was a table set-up as if it were an informal dinner in the garden, therefore, the floral decoration consisted of a multitude of vases with single flower stems, for a very casual effect. The show-plates of the master Nicola Fasano, a must-have in Apulian summer homes, contributed to creating that familiar but always refined atmosphere, just as Helena and Vahid desired.
